Top hotels in Florence

Palace Editor's pick

Four Seasons Hotel Florence

Oltrarno

A 15th-century Renaissance palace with a private 4.5-hectare garden — the largest in Florence. The Michelin-starred Il Palagio and the spa are both world-class.

Palace

Hotel Savoy

Piazza della Repubblica

A Rocco Forte classic on the most central square in Florence. The rooftop terrace, Irene restaurant and beautifully refurbished rooms are all exceptional.

Luxury

Portrait Firenze

Lungarno Acciaiuoli

Lungarno Collection's finest property with 15 exclusive suites overlooking the Arno. Breakfast on the Ponte Vecchio terrace is one of Florence's great pleasures.

Palace

Villa Cora

Poggio Imperiale

A 19th-century villa above Florence with a magnificent outdoor pool, spa and gardens. Empresses and princes have stayed here and the grandeur remains intact.

Palace

Belmond Villa San Michele

Fiesole

A 15th-century monastery in the hills of Fiesole with a façade attributed to Michelangelo. The infinity pool and views of Florence are simply unforgettable.
